#1 Reshaping our Young Hub Week: Sharpen your consulting skills from day one

In an ever-changing world, we believe in continuous improvement. Next to implementing this mindset with our clients, we practice what we preach within our own company and revise our business processes and trainings regularly.

Instead of focusing mainly on hard skills, we moved towards consulting skills and soft skills, which we believe are vital for young graduates. Vital skills such as: interviewing, data analysis, presentation skills, project management,.…

#4 Conversation tables: language as a connecting factor

Pardon my French. Je n’ai pas compris. Wat zeg je? Language can often be a barrier, a hindrance in communicating with others. It can fuel certain insecurities and create noise on the communication line. But it doesn’t always have to be that way. Language can also be a way to connect or serve as an inspiration. At TriFinance and TriHD, learning culture goes far beyond hard skills and technical (professional) knowledge. To break down this language barrier and work on their soft skills at the same time, we immerse our employees in an informal language ‘bath’: the conversation tables.
